Anthropic Claude Code Source Leak Exposes 512K Lines, 'Memory' Architecture, and Upcoming AI Features
A significant source code leak has exposed the inner workings of Anthropic's Claude Code, revealing over 512,000 lines of TypeScript and offering a rare, unfiltered look into the AI coding assistant's development. The leak occurred when the Claude Code 2.1.88 update inadvertently included a source map file containing the project's entire codebase. This data trove, first highlighted by users on social media, provides unprecedented insight into the tool's architecture, including its core instructions and memory systems, which are typically closely guarded secrets in the competitive AI industry.
Analysts and users digging through the leaked code claim to have uncovered details of upcoming features and the specific operational guidelines, or 'constitution,' that govern the AI's behavior. Among the discoveries are references to experimental functionalities, including a Tamagotchi-style interactive 'pet' and the framework for an 'always-on' agent capability. These findings suggest Anthropic is exploring more persistent and personalized AI interactions beyond its current coding assistance role.
The exposure places immediate pressure on Anthropic's security and release protocols, raising questions about internal safeguards for proprietary AI technology. While the leak does not necessarily indicate a direct security vulnerability for end-users, it provides competitors and researchers with a detailed blueprint of Anthropic's technical direction and implementation strategies. This incident triggers scrutiny over how leading AI firms manage their intellectual property in fast-paced development cycles and could influence how future updates are packaged and distributed to prevent similar exposures.